一. 思路分析 思路1: 獲取文件大小, 驗證文件大小是否為0(可以使用os庫或pathlib庫) 思路2: 讀取文件的第一個字符, 驗證第一個字符是否存在 二. 實現方法 方法1: 思路1 + os庫的path方法 方法2: 思路1 + os庫的stat方法 ...
一. 思路分析 思路1: 獲取文件大小, 驗證文件大小是否為0(可以使用os庫或pathlib庫) 思路2: 讀取文件的第一個字符, 驗證第一個字符是否存在 二. 實現方法 方法1: 思路1 + os庫的path方法 方法2: 思路1 + os庫的stat方法 ...
text_path="/xxx/xxx"def clear(): with open(text_path, 'w') as f1: f1.seek(0) f1.truncate() print("清空 ...
一:文件內容清空問題: 在工作中我們有時候還會清空文件中的內容 然后再重新寫入新的內容,哪如何清空已存文件的內容呢? 解決方法: 執行上面這個函數,它會把內容追加進去,而不是替換。 f.truncate()沒起作用,應該怎么寫才可以呢? 需要加上f.seek(0),把文件 ...
Linux系統中一切皆文件。 所以在清空或刪除文件之前一定要確保該文件不是系統文件或者其他重要配置文件,否則可能引發系統錯誤。 一、通過重定向來清空文件內容 該方法是最簡單的,通過shell重定向null到指定文件即可 $ > system.log 還有兩個 ...
轉自stackoverflow: http://stackoverflow.com/questions/115983/how-do-i-add-an-empty-directory-to-a-gi ...
之前發現很多項目文件夾下又.gitkeep文件,不知道它的用處。 直到前段時間遇到一個問題,Git如何上傳空文件夾? 默認情況下,Git不會上傳本地空文件夾,如果有些特殊場合需要的話,一個簡單的方法是在這個文件夾下建一個.gitkeep之類的文件,自然會把這個文件夾上傳。 其實在git中 ...
問題描述: 有時,我們的文件夾太多了,但有的文件夾還是空的文件夾,自己去刪需要好久,於是想着寫個腳本自動刪除。代碼如下: ...
...